Title:
GROUND IMPROVING AGENT AND METHOD FOR IMPROVING
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JP2001139948
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

To obtain a ground improving agent solidifying ground rigidly and economically preventing elution of hexavalent chromium from the solidified ground by a simple method.

This ground-improving agent is characterized by comprising a mixture of a cement-based solidifying agent and powder of coal or lignite. The coal is brown coal or anthracite. Blast-furnace slag, ferrous sulfate, quick lime or slaked lime can be included in the ground-improving agent. The method for its production comprises applying the cement-based solidifying agent including coal or lignite powder to soil or comprises adding the powder of coal or lignite to the cement-solidifying agent and mixing the resultant mixture with the soil.
